Fit and Adjustability
Choosing a toddler’s helmet with adjustable fit features is essential for both safety and comfort. A reliable sizing system, like a dial or multiple straps, helps ensure a snug, secure fit as your child grows. Proper adjustability makes it easy to customize the helmet, accommodating head size changes without sacrificing safety. Helmets with adjustable straps and fit systems prevent slipping or looseness during active play, reducing injury risk. The fit adjustment mechanism should be simple to operate—quick and secure—so fitting is hassle-free for parents and kids alike. Covering a broad range of head sizes, an adjustable helmet offers long-term usability and peace of mind. Ultimately, a well-designed adjustment system guarantees that the helmet stays in place and provides ideal protection during every adventure.
Material Durability
Selecting a helmet made from durable materials is essential for ensuring your toddler’s safety during active play. Impact-resistant ABS shells and reinforced EPS foam are key, as they provide long-lasting protection during falls and collisions. High-quality construction minimizes cracks, chips, or breakage, so the helmet maintains its safety integrity over time. The materials chosen also influence resistance to wear, moisture, and UV exposure, ensuring the helmet remains effective in different environments. A lightweight yet sturdy design helps reduce strain on your child’s neck while still absorbing impacts effectively. Certified safety-grade materials, like those meeting CPSC and ASTM standards, guarantee that the helmet not only lasts but also complies with safety regulations, giving you peace of mind during your child’s adventures.
Ventilation Efficiency
Ensuring good ventilation in a toddler helmet is essential for comfort and safety during active play. I look for helmets with multiple air vents, usually between 10 and 14, which help promote airflow and keep heat from building up. Strategic placement of vents on the top, sides, and rear ensures natural airflow, preventing sweating and overheating. Lightweight materials combined with a ventilated design further reduce heat retention, making extended wear more comfortable. I also prefer helmets with removable, washable padding that maintains airflow and hygiene over time. Proper ventilation not only keeps toddlers cooler but also makes outdoor activities more enjoyable by preventing discomfort caused by excessive heat. Prioritizing these features helps me select a helmet that’s both safe and comfortable for active little ones.

Safety Certifications
Safety certifications like CPSC and ASTM are essential indicators that a toddler helmet meets strict safety standards. These certifications confirm the helmet has passed rigorous testing for impact resistance, shock absorption, durability, and coverage. When a helmet carries dual certification from recognized agencies, it provides added reassurance of reliable protection across various outdoor activities. Certified helmets typically include features like impact-absorbing foam and sturdy outer shells, which markedly reduce head injury risks. To ensure a helmet is safe, always check for official safety labels or certification marks. These marks indicate the helmet has been tested and approved specifically for toddler use. Prioritizing certified helmets helps ensure your child’s safety and peace of mind during outdoor adventures.

How Do I Ensure the Helmet Fits My Toddler Properly?
To make sure your toddler’s helmet fits properly, I recommend measuring their head with a soft tape measure around the widest part. The helmet should sit snugly without pinching and sit level on their head, covering the forehead just above the eyebrows. Always check the fit after adjusting straps, ensuring they’re secure but comfortable. A well-fitting helmet keeps your little one safe and comfortable during their adventures.

How Often Should I Replace My Child’s Helmet?
I get asked how often to replace a child’s helmet, and I always recommend checking the manufacturer’s guidelines. Generally, you should replace it after a crash, or every 2 to 5 years due to wear and tear. Kids grow quickly, so verify the helmet fits snugly and comfortably. Regularly inspect for cracks or damage, and don’t hesitate to replace it if anything looks suspicious to keep your little one safe.
